    the rain has stopped in our area...
    creeks our dry. ponds are drying up. an associate in our county has 2 ponds... both are empty.

    last night, before church, our water pressure dropped. we'd just finished our showers...
    it has happened before... both times, I had "taken out part of the plumbing."
    so we were desperately looking for ponds of water caused by a ruptured incoming pipe...
    no self made leaks.

    we headed to church and no water at all at the church. the phones were lighting up.
    "no water at our house. what about yours?"
    folks were gathering but they couldn't flush the commodes.
    no one knew why the water wasn't flowing.

    we raced home to the condo, where there is a well. and filled two containers with about 100 gallons of water for the water closets.

    ladies looked relieved..

    soon, word got to the church that the village had found the ruptured pipe and begun to repair the pipe.

    but, it brought on a good topic of conversation. "what if... there is no water in the city pipes?"
    the first answer was... well, we'd just go down to the creek or to tim's pond.
    and the response was tim's pond is empty and the creek has been dry for over 2 months.

    other people in the area have wells, but the water level is dropping.. if the drought continues and the farmers keep pumping..
    no mo' wawa.
    just something to consider.
    we have a big tank, that we haven't filled. hmm.. what if there had been no electricity to run the wells.
